Description
Rudyard Kipling's Indian years were a defining period in his life, marked by both hardship and creative flourishing. In 1882, at the age of 17, he returned to India after a difficult experience in England, where he was sent to work on The Civil and Military Gazette with the words 'Kipling will do'. This book tells the story of Kipling's Indian childhood and coming of age, as well as his abandonment in England, through the eyes of Charles Allen. Allen sheds light on the experiences of Kipling's parents, Lockwood and Alice, and reveals the cultural influences that shaped young Rudyard. The result is a work of sympathetic biography that neither shies away from Kipling's flaws nor romanticises his love for India.
